**Action item:** Waveform previews in Chorusline rendered blank for uploads over 40 minutes because the preview worker timed out silently. Fix ships next sprint; until then, advise affected users that playback still works and previews regenerate overnight. Don't escalate these as data-loss tickets. The workaround script and known-affected formats are listed on the page below.

operations page: https://confluence.tolvaqsys.corp/spaces/pages/pages/6e787158f507

## Trophy Engraving Run — Marrowgate Awards Night

The engraved trophies for the Marrowgate staff awards return from Fennick Engraving on Friday. Driver's coordinator books a single direct run, no interim stops. Trophies travel boxed and foam-packed; the headline cup rides up front. Delivery is to the Halden Suite loading door before 15:00. The hand-over line for the courier follows below.

handover note for yagef-bagep: the drudor pelius courier leaves the kasdor zorvan norir ledger at gate 8016 under passcode 755406

Subject: Handover — cron migration to Orlix Flows

Hi all,

Welcome to the release rotation. Over the next two sprints we're moving the remaining nightly cron jobs on the Pemberfield hosts into the Orlix workflow engine. Please migrate one job at a time, keep the legacy cron entry commented (not deleted) for a full cycle, and confirm the Orlix run log before cutting over. Marit owns the billing exports; coordinate with her first. Each migrated workflow bundle must be signed before deploy, using the key below.

deploy key for kajof-yawif: bky9_fvxrpdHPq